I voted for black aswell...think of it this way, if ya ever get bored of the Bike and want to get a differant one, Black is obviously pretty neutral so it wont matter what color you get and not have to worry about purchasing another helmet than.

another thing....have you riddin with a smoked lense at nite yet?? if not, than take my word for it...dont. its near impossible to see out of it at nite. i would find myself having to ride with the visor up untill i just started switching them over from smoked to clear as it got darker. than that got to be a pain in the arse so i just left the clear on..lol.
